🙂A single person spends $3,524 per month in Rheinfelden vs $4,164 in Geneva,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$5,497 per month in Rheinfelden vs $6,467 in Geneva,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$7,469 per month in Rheinfelden vs $8,770 in Geneva, rent included.
🙂Rheinfelden is about 15% cheaper than Geneva, driven mainly by Eating Out.
📊Both Rheinfelden and Geneva sit above the global median – Rheinfelden by 162%, Geneva by 210%.

🏠A central one-bedroom costs $1,680 in Rheinfelden versus $2,339 in Geneva.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$106 in Rheinfelden versus $145 in Geneva.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$632 vs $676 – making Rheinfelden the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
